CHICAGO, Ill. - Playing two schools they had never faced before, the Davenport volleyball team improved to 6-3 on the year with a pair of wins. DU defeated Lourdes and Roosevelt by identical 3-1 scores and they will remain in Chicago on Saturday to face Morningside (Iowa) and the host Cougars.
In match one Davenport used a strong start in each of their three victories to overcome a sluggish set four. DU defeated new WHAC foe Lourdes College in a non-conference matchup 3-1 (25-22, 25-21, 23-25, 25-16). In each of their three wins, DU was able to get out in front and stay there but in their lone loss, the Panthers fell behind 9-1 and never recovered.
Leading the way offensively in the win over the Grey Wolves was junior
Kassie Graves who finished with a team high 12 kills. Fellow junior
Brittany Bott posted 10 while red-shirt freshman
Amber Getty dished out 20 assists. Leading the way on defense were
Courtney DePriest with 17 digs and Graves with 16.
In the second match vs. Roosevelt (Ill.), Davenport used a strong offensive attack to down the Lakers in four sets. The Panthers won a close set one 25-22, but cruised in the second 25-12 before falling by the slimmest of margins in set three 26-24. Davenport rebounded once again to close out their second straight opponent in four with a 25-18 win.
Graves again led the way for DU as she finished with 18 kills on 36 attempts for a .306 hitting percentage. She was one of three Panthers to finish in double digits for kills as Bott posted 11 and freshman
Hannah Stone 10.
Post-Match Quotes
Head Coach Megan Garner
- On: Playing two brand new opponents
"It was good to see new competition and both were very scrappy and forced us to be creative on offense. We lost a little focus in the third set of each match but winning both gives us some momentum heading into tomorrow against two very good teams."
Post-Match Notes
The wins were the 4th and 5th consecutive for the volleyball team…It marked the first time in school history that DU has played Lourdes and Roosevelt…Lourdes will join the WHAC this year but this match was played as a non-conference match
